Amidst an era where seasoned travelers actively seek alternatives to crowded tourist spots, Collette’s “Japan: Past & Present” tour emerges as a refreshing choice. This 14-day small group Explorations tour marks a strategic pivot by Collette towards sustainable travel, featuring a thoughtfully balanced itinerary. It not only covers essential sights but also introduces participants to off-the-beaten-path locations that capture the true essence and culture of Japan. Stays in lesser-known areas like Ise-Shima and Mt. Koya allow for in-depth exploration of Japan’s hidden treasures.

Pioneering Sustainable Travel Strategies

In the current travel scene, discerning travelers are increasingly in pursuit of unique and immersive experiences while destinations worldwide face the challenge of overtourism. This issue, recently discussed at the World Economic Forum in Davos, underscores the severe impact of mass tourism, which can erode local environments, overload infrastructure, and reduce the quality of life for inhabitants.

Collette’s forward-thinking strategy addresses these challenges by fostering travel experiences that explore local cultures more deeply and promote lesser-known, emerging destinations.

Explore Authentic Japan with Collette’s “Japan: Past & Present” Tour

Delve into the heart of Japanese culture with Collette’s immersive “Japan: Past & Present” tour. Participants will enjoy a unique sushi-making demonstration at the renowned WAK in Kyoto. This interactive experience is further enriched by a session on sake tasting paired with origami folding, offering a deep dive into Japan’s renowned culinary arts and meticulous craftsmanship.
